Indonesia as an emerging country has a lot of traffic bottleneck challenges on urban road networks including in Banda Aceh, the capital of Aceh province. It is due to high traffic demand and limited supply of roadway. Consequently, traffic congestion leads to several externalities such as unnecessary travel times, air pollution, energy consumption, and driver frustration. An unsystematic bottleneck defines as a bottleneck that is without any changes in roadway geometric, and sometimes refers to hidden or virtual bottlenecks. Therefore, I wrote a basic traffic engineering book emphasizing the dynamic capacity method with application on virtual bottlenecks assessments. This book is aimed at undergraduate and postgraduate civil engineers particularly dealing with traffic planning and operation at the virtual bottlenecks. This book is essentially distinguished into six chapters. Chapter I and II deals with the traffic mechanism at unsystematic bottlenecks and its theoretical foundation for assessing the speed and capacity drops due to an active unsystematic bottleneck. The fundamental theory of static and dynamic approaches has been comprehensively discussed in this part. The following part of the chapter, III-VI covers practical assessment by considering U-turn and On-street parking bottlenecks as case studies including simulation methods to determine measures of the effectiveness of the design improvements. Data preparation, observation, analysis, and simulation are broadly deliberated for easy understanding for undergraduate and postgraduate university students. While this book is further intended for traffic engineering practitioners. I suppose that it will also be worth practicing for traffic and transport engineers as designers or planners.

Traffic congestion has been a serious social and technical problem since the early year's rapid motorization in Banda Aceh, Aceh Province Indonesia. Urban arterial performance becomes the crucial concerns of many traffic engineers. This study examined the impact of presence of u-turn and on-street parking on deterioration both travel speed and operated capacity.Arterial performances were analyzed using oblique cumulative plots and breakdown method as known as dynamic capacity methods.
